Key improvements to the Nissan E-Power system:

E-power Unit: A new modular 5-in-1 unit integrates the engine, generator, inverter, reducer, and multiplier into a single compact and lightweight block. Motor calibration and acoustic insulation improvements reduce noise and vibration.
Increased Electric Motor Power: The power of the electric motor has been increased to 150 kW.
Starc Combustion Engine: The 1.5-liter three-cylinder gasoline engine now utilizes the patented Starc combustion concept, improving thermal efficiency and reducing noise at low speeds. It also eliminates the need for variable compression.
New Turbo: A larger turbocharger has been installed, reducing engine RPM by 200 on highways, which reduces cabin noise.
Lubricant oil: Switching to 0W16 lubricant oil reduces internal friction.
Extended Service Intervals: Service intervals have been extended from 15,000 km to 20,000 km.
Fuel Efficiency: The new E-Power generation achieves up to 16% lower fuel consumption in real-world conditions and 14% lower consumption on highways.
Range: The system offers a real autonomy of over 1200 km, which is better than traditional plug-in hybrids.No charging cable or waiting for the car to load entirely is required.

understanding Nissan e-POWER Technology

At its core, the Nissan e-POWER system is a series hybrid setup. This architecture distinguishes it from parallel hybrid systems and plug-in hybrids. The Gasoline engine operates as a generator, supplying electricity to the high-capacity battery pack and/or the electric motor. The electric motor then solely propels the vehicle’s wheels. This allows for a smooth, responsive driving experience associated with electric vehicles while maintaining the range benefits of a gasoline engine.

How e-POWER Differs from Traditional Hybrids

The key difference lies in the role of the engine.

  • Traditional Hybrids: These systems use the engine to drive the wheels directly, working in tandem with an electric motor.
  • Nissan e-POWER: The engine solely charges the battery, never directly powering the wheels. The electric motor is the sole driver, offering instant torque and seamless acceleration.

This unique arrangement of the Nissan e-POWER technology makes it a more efficient vehicle,especially in urban environments where electric-only driving is prevalent.

Improved Fuel Efficiency

by optimizing the engine’s operation to act primarily as a generator, e-POWER maximizes fuel efficiency. the engine runs most efficiently at a constant speed, minimizing wasted energy. This leads to better fuel economy compared to traditional internal combustion engine (ICE) vehicles and competitive results when compared to standard hybrid engines. The constant-speed design also keeps the car from creating unnecessary noise, promoting refinement.

Regenerative Braking

Nissan e-POWER incorporates regenerative braking, capturing energy during deceleration and braking. This captured energy is then channeled back into the battery pack, extending the electric driving range and further enhancing fuel efficiency. This is also similar to hybrid models and EV’s.
